/cOYj1M53EegUua0tmVD0LueQzed.jpg

Wales v. Ireland at Wrexham

No Tagline

3 Mins

1906-05-23

No Language

Overview

A film from the UK based Mitchell & Kenyon.

Rating

50%

Cast